Job Description Summary:

A Wrap Machine Operator is responsible for the operation of wrapping equipment. An operator performs functions necessary to accomplish complete changeovers on box formers and wrapping equipment, and adjustments necessary to maintain operation of the equipment while it is running to ensure an acceptable wrap.
